Lufkin is ideally
situated for those who enjoy small town convenience with all
the big city amenities. At approximately 40,000 in
population, Lufkin is the largest community
between
Tyler in northeast Texas and Houston on the Texas Coast and
is conveniently equidistant to both providing the ultimate
location for the good life. Located at the junction of
Hwy’s 69 (to Tyler, Beaumont and Port Arthur) and 59 (to
Houston, Longview, and Shreveport) and bisected by El Camino
Real “hwy 103” connecting East Texas to Natchitoches and
central Louisiana Lufkin is also rich in transportation.

Unlike
other comfortably small communities, Lufkin is also home to
both award winning mass transit and municipal Airports.
The
Brazos Transit District one of the largest and
heaviest used rural mass transit districts in the state
serves all of Lufkin and the surrounding areas and is housed
at Jennings station, a beautiful new transit station located
in the heart of historic downtown Lufkin. Jennings Station
will also serve inter and intra-state bus lines and is
designed to accommodate Taxi service in the future as
needed.
Angelina Airport,Texas
Department of Transportation’s Airport of the year in 1997
continues to grow in both capacity and use. One of the
cleanest and best run small airports in Texas, Angelina
Airport is home to corporate fleets, private planes and
military training hops and search and rescue operations
alike. The airport hosts 50 – 150 private airplanes every
month at one of the largest fly-ins in the region many of
which come to enjoy the “best hamburgers in Texas” at the
airport café. The local Experimental Aircraft Association
comprised of some of the areas best and most avid pilots
also provide free plane rides to youngsters at each month’s
fly-ins to educate youth about the wonders or aeronautics
and help promote the next generation of pilots.
Lufkin
is also served by Industrial Rail provided by the
Angelina and Neches
River Railroad with direct connection to the
Union Pacific mainline.
